What is the code for lead on a flat roof?

Code 7 Lead Code 7 is the most durable option for pitched roofing applications, as Code 8 is far more suitable for flat roofing. It cannot be used as a soaker, as flashing or as vertical cladding.

How long does a lead flat roof last?

100 years
Lead roofing products tend to have a lifespan in excess of 60 years, with many examples of the material lasting over 100 years.

Is lead good for a flat roof?

Lead is commonly used for flat roofs because of it’s long life and ability to be formed to fit many positions.

What is lead flashing on a roof?

Lead flashing is a piece of milled lead that sits between joints to create a durable and weathertight seal. Lead flashing has been used for hundreds of years in situations such as where a roof meets a wall, on a roof valley, around other penetrations such as chimneys, pipes, and around window and door openings.

What is Code 3 lead?

Code 3 lead is the thinnest gauge of lead used in commercial roofing and is suitable for light applications such as soakers at the abutment..

Can you repair lead?

When lead does split the correct way to repair it is to weld a piece of lead over the split. This is quite an advanced procedure which was always historically in the plumbers domain of jobs. Very few plumbers these days know how to weld lead and its very different to welding steel or ali.

Can a lead roof be repaired?

When repairing lead roofing, a roofer may use new lead sheet and carefully weld is over any split or cracks. This is a cost-effective way to repair tired lead. We and other roofers often find that the cause of lead roofing failure is due to the roll ends, which haven’t been secured effectively.

How do you fall on a flat roof?

The fall of the roof may be created in the structure itself by laying the supporting beams, or joists at a slope (giving a sloping soffit) or by installing tapered beams with horizontal soffits. It is normal practice for the joists of a flat roof to be set level thus creating a perfectly level ceiling.

Is lead still used on roofs?

Lead is one of the oldest materials in the roofing industry and is still commonly used throughout the world today. In light of this, it is safe to say that lead has proven itself to be a reliable and durable material, excellent for roofing purposes.

Is lead waterproof?

Lead Waterproofing Membranes: When installed correctly a lead membrane is impregnable to water and moisture and can last hundreds of years.
